AQUA Executive Committee position descriptions

The AQUA Committee meets for an hour every two months. Its decision-making processes have a tradition of being informal and consensus based. The official roles are described in the Organisation's Constitution but further details about the day to day roles are provided below.

PRESIDENT

The AQUA President is responsible for representing the organisation both internally and externally.  The President chairs Committee meetings and the Annual General Meeting and is responsible for writing a small piece ("From the President's Pen") in each issue of Quaternary Australasia.

VICE PRESIDENT

The Vice President undertakes the President's role in their absence, contributes to overall decision making by the Executive Committee and may lead subcommittees.

SECRETARY

The Secretary is responsible for arranging Committee meetings and the Annual General Minutes and taking and distributing minutes. They are also responsible for the keeping of all official documents excluding financial, including the register of members (the latter mostly done automatically via the website these days).

TREASURER

The Treasurer is responsible for AQUA's financial activities, including those related to the AQUA Conference (in collaboration with the local organisers). In addition to the "day to day" activities, The Treasurer is responsible for reporting to Annual General Meeting on the organisation's financial position. Some banking authority is also shared with other committee members.

NB: The Treasurer must be an Australian Resident (for banking purposes)

COMMUNICATIONS OFFICER

The Communications and IT Coordinator is responsible for maintaining the Aqua website and social media accounts (primarily the @AusQuaternary Twitter account). This includes working with the editors of QA to upload the QA magazine and organisers of the biennial AQUA conference to facilitate conference registration and abstract submission.

EDITOR/S

The Editor of Quaternary Australasia is responsible for soliciting and preparing contributions from AQUA members for biannual publication. This includes copyediting, writing editorials, coordinating peer review, and liaising with an external graphic designer.
